Join us as we cut invasive shrubs from this oak-hickory woodland. Catch views of Mallet’s Creek, a pond, and a wetland full of wildlife as you help us restore this beautiful area. Controlled burns have been used to control the invasive shrubs in this park in previous years. As we weren’t able to conduct our Spring burn season this year, this area especially needs your help in getting rid of invasive shrubs. Come join us!
